Abstract:
Abstract In September 2023, only 15% of the SDGs have been achieved, and there is a shortfall of between $5,400 and $6,400 billion a year to meet the 2030 Agenda. This chapter looks at the different financing vehicles, then focuses on social impact bonds. It presents the financial set-up and examines the measurement techniques used to assess the impact of sustainable finance.
